Criteria for the best bone broth powder

The two most important criteria for the best bone broth supplements to buy are:

  • Certified organic
  • 100% grass-fed

When it comes to nutrition, bone broth that comes from 100% grass-fed beef is much more nutritious and carries more healthy compounds.  These include more vitamin K2, antioxidants, healthy minerals, and omega-3 fats. 

Plus, it is better for the environment and for the cows too. 

So, the best bone broth to buy would ideally be both certified organic and 100% grass-fed.  

But, after countless hours looking for products like this, you can find either one or the other. 

Typically, you can more easily find certified organic chicken broth powder.  

100% grass-fed beef broth is much more challenging to find, but you can find a few organic beef bone broth powders out there. 

Other important criteria to look for in bone broth powders are:

  • GMP or 3rd party certified
  • Free of fillers when possible
  • Free of allergens
  • High in protein-at least 10 grams per serving
  • Tastes great

Keep in mind, that bone broth powders are going to often have a slight bone broth taste.  This isn’t unpleasant for most people, but it could be a flavor that some people aren’t used to.

    Bone broth powder benefits

    Bone broth powder has numerous health benefits that promote a healthy body.  It contains many healthy compounds including:

    • Multiple amino acids
    • Glucosamine
    • Chondroitin
    • Glycine
    • Glutamine
    • Hyaluronic acid
    • Proline
    • Leucine
    • Collagen

    These compounds can help with the following aspects of health when used regularly. 

    Provides critical nutrients for health

    Most people don’t get enough collagen, glucosamine, and certain amino acids in their diets because of modern lifestyles.  

    Luckily, bone broth powder provides all of these nutrients to help support almost every tissue in your body. 

    Collagen is your body’s most abundant protein.  In fact, 1/3 of all the protein in your body is collagen!  

    A great way to support collagen tissue in your body is to eat bone broth. This helps your body to be flexible, strong, and supple. 

    Plus, bone broth contains a rare form of collagen called type II collagen that helps build many kinds of connective tissue in the body. 

    Weight loss

    Diets high in protein foods like bone broth powder can help with weight loss and increase muscle mass.  This is because the protein and amino acids are filling and help support benefits on whole-body metabolism according to research [R].  

    By containing all essential amino acids and conditionally essential amino acids, bone broth may help curb appetite. 

    The collagen in bone broth may even help the body make proper amounts of insulin [R]. 

    Skin health, nail health, hair health

    The nutrients in bone broth help support healthy skin, hair, and nails, especially its abundant collagen content. 

    As you may know, the primary protein in skin tissue is collagen.

    To get enough collagen to support glowing and healthy skin,  it is best to eat collagen-rich foods like bone broth. 


    Plus, bone broth also contains hyaluronic acid and proline which may slow the aging processes in the skin [R, R]. 

    Adding bone broth after age 40 may be especially helpful because this is the age when our skin production of collagen declines. Many people swear by the benefits of collagen for reducing wrinkles. 

    Research even shows that collagen helps increase skin elasticity and hydration [R].

    Helpful for reducing joint pain

    Collagen from bone broth powder is great for joint health. 

    In fact, there are countless studies that show that collagen helps reduce joint pain [R]. 

    This healing nutrient helps to decrease inflammation and is a critical building block for joint tissues.

    Great for building muscle and bone density

    Bone broth may help improve muscle strength and bone density according to research.  This makes sense because collagen from bone broth plays a big role in making up the structure of bone tissue. 

    Collagen peptides along with calcium and vitamin D increased bone density in women with low bone density [R]. 

    Collagen from bone broth along with vitamin D and calcium also reduces bone loss in postmenopausal women [R]. 

    Keep in mind, that exercise is critical for supporting bone and muscle health so it is best to use bone broth with a healthy exercise routine.

    Reduces inflammation

    Bone broth has natural anti-inflammatory nutrients, including glycine, glutamine, glucosamine, and chondroitin. 

    For example, glycine alone reduces inflammation in the body according to research [R].  

    This means that bone broth may help a wide variety of health issues. 

    By helping to heal a leaky gut, bone broth may help reduce inflammation throughout the whole body. [R, R]. 

    Helps gut health

    Bone broth is notorious for its gut health benefits.  This is because it contains gut-healing amino acids, glutamine, and collagen.  As such, it helps to reduce inflammation in the gut, heals the gut lining, helps make bile, and supports a healthy immune system. 

    Additionally, collagen may help make bowel movements easier because it pulls water towards it.  By helping to heal the gut lining and promoting healthy intestinal muscles, it helps with normal bowel function too.

    May improve sleep quality

    Bone broth contains an amino acid that helps support healthy sleep: glycine. 

    Glycine helps to increase sleep quality and even helps to improve daytime memory according to research in the Sleep and Biological Rhythms Journal and Neuropsychopharmacology Journal [R, R]. 

    Great for Keto, Paleo, and Anti-inflammatory diets

    Bone broth is naturally free of inflammatory carbohydrates and provides healing nutrients. 

    For this reason, it is suitable for many healthy meal plans.  These include ketogenic meal plans, Paleo lifestyles, and autoimmune protocols.

    Frequently asked questions

    How is bone broth powder made?

    Bone broth powder is simply made by cooking chicken bones or beef bones in water.  Typically this is done under high pressure and constant heat for a short period of time to help retain its nutrients. 

    Then, the powder is dried, typically at a low temperature to help keep its quality. 

    Does bone broth contain heavy metals?

    There is a chance that there can be trace amounts of heavy metals in bone broth powder, even organic types. 

    However, like most foods, these levels are lower than EPA-acceptable levels. 

    Because bone broth is helpful for healing the gut, your body is less likely to absorb these heavy metals. 

    And, most foods these days sadly have a risk of heavy metals, including fruits and vegetables. So, I don’t believe that bone broth is more concerning than any other food for this reason.
